OK, group of us riding out of Stowe area for a few days in August. One trip will be to the Adirondacks. Looking for a good route and some great roads once in the Adirondacks. Also some good places to stop; sites, bars, restaurants up in the Adirondacks. Will probably make Lake Placid a stop.
Ausable Chasm on Rt. 9, Whiteface Mountain in Wilmington, Mirror Lake, Steak/Seafood House Restaurant in Lake Placid.
My favorite roads of all time: 86, 3, 30, 28N, 28. Take a break on Rt. 30 at Long Lake's only Bridge, Town Park/Swimming. Also, Rt. 30 at Fish Creek's Campground, Ask for visitor's pass to tour the beautiful 'one way' campground.
Daikers Bar/Restaurant on Fourth Lake on 28, Tony Harper's Pizza and Clam Shack in Downtown Old Forge and White Birch Café in Tupper Lake's good too.

Lake George is also a good stop as well as you mentioned Lake Placid. A little further south is Nick's Waterfall House in Gilboa, real old school biker dive. Good burgers, cheap beer and great view of the falls.
